In critical applications of rotary mechanical seals, disc springs must deliver exceptionally precise axial preload forces. This requires not only uniform force distribution across contact surfaces but also sustained high stability during prolonged continuous operation, effectively preventing seal performance degradation caused by force attenuation or fluctuations. The 2528mm series disc springs engineered per DIN2093 standards are specifically developed for such high-performance environments. These components consistently provide accurate and stable end-face compression forces across various mechanical seal systems, ensuring long-term tight sealing integrity and zero media leakage. This robust performance guarantees both operational reliability and safety throughout the entire sealing system.
Typical product parameters (using model 001 085 as an example)
Outer diameter D: 25.00 mm
Inner diameter d: 12.20 mm
Single sheet thickness t: 1.00 mm
Free state height H₀: 1.80 mm
Rated load at compression to 25% free height: 585 N
Rated load at compression to 50% free height: 1021 N
In mechanical sealing systems, disc springs demonstrate their core functionality through exceptional dynamic compensation capabilities. These components effectively and promptly compensate for minor axial dimensional variations caused by normal progressive wear on sealing surfaces or environmental temperature fluctuations, ensuring continuous tight contact between sealing surfaces under all operational conditions to fundamentally prevent fluid leakage. The disc spring series is renowned for its consistent force output, superior stress relaxation resistance, and excellent fatigue durability, fully meeting stringent requirements for continuous, long-cycle, and stable industrial applications.
Core value demonstrated in sealing applications:
Ø Effective wear compensation: Capable of automatically and precisely compensating for progressive wear on sealing surfaces, significantly extending the service life of the entire mechanical seal assembly while reducing maintenance frequency and replacement costs.
Ø Ensuring sealing performance: By providing uniform and consistently stable preload force, it ensures optimal contact at the sealing interface and rational pressure distribution, thereby achieving long-term and superior sealing results.
Ø Adaptability to complex operating conditions: Capable of effectively handling temperature fluctuations and pressure variations during operation, maintaining consistent preload and sealing performance with high overall reliability and broad applicability.
